Coach Husser Tallies 200th Win
by Bea Peterson
The HFCS Girls Soccer Team helped Coach Tom Husser earn his 200th win in a game against Tamarac, at home, on Thursday, October 11. Husser has been coaching the team for 11 years, 2001 through 2012. During that time he has built an impressive record. He has had three trips to States, 2005, 2007, 2011, and they have won the title twice, in 2005 and 2011. Last year Husser was named NY State Coach of the Year. [Read more…] about Coach Husser Tallies 200th Win

Berlin Boys Varsity Soccer Sinks Waterford, Heatly
Berlin 1, Waterford 0
Waterford and Berlin fought out another close contest on Thursday, October 11, with both teams playing well defensively and somehow trying to find the offensive finish. Much of the game was played between the 18s, with both sides having trouble combining for a good shot on goal. The game was decided with about 30 seconds to go in the second overtime, when the Mountaineers’ Cody Seel lofted a ball over one Waterford defender outside the 18 and the ball dropped to Jacob Mills alongside the last Fordian defender. Mills settled the ball and held off the defender and slid the ball past the keeper for the last gasp win. Berlin’s Sakan Sadowsky and Waterford’s Josh Orton were the standouts in the game. Both teams played well in this close contest.
Berlin 5, Heatly 1
The Berlin Boys Varsity Soccer Team defeated Heatly 5 to 1 on Tuesday, October 16 .
Jacob Mills scored three goals, Christian Price and Kyle Burdick scored a goal apiece. Damian Degennaro and Jacob Mills had an assist.
The team can win the CHVL League Championship with a win Monday at Doane Stuart.
